Hi all, I fixed another long time hidden bug in the TCP socket code. There had been two integer overflow in NutTcpDeviceWrite() and NutTcpReceive() Both functions suffered from size calculations based on uint16_t variables, which resulted in integer overflows, when calling these functions with buffer sizes > 64K. As result NutTcpDeviceWrite() send out the wrong number of bytes, but always returned, that it correctly wrote the whole buffer size. So when calling write() or fwrite() on a socket with a buffer larger than 64K you likely would have lost data on the socket. Same could perhaps have happened when calling fread() or read() on a socket with large buffers.
